Default Seat Color Fade Anybody?

My '04 drivers side front seat left side bolster has stated to loose its color. Anybody else had trouble with wear on the seats?

Default Re: Seat Color Fade Anybody?

I have noticed the same thing in the same place. I have touched it up with a leather cleaner wipe and it seems to recover a bit, but I have scratched the surface of the bolster and now watch it carefully when I get in or out. I'm not into sheepskin seat covers so if I do wear through I will be visiting the upholstery shop for work.
